Finished Floor Installation in Fort Worth, TX
Finished floor installation services involve the professional setup of various flooring materials to enhance the appearance and functionality of interior spaces. These projects can include installing hardwood, laminate, tile, vinyl, or carpet flooring in areas such as living rooms, bedrooms, kitchens, and hallways. Property owners typically seek these services when renovating, updating, or replacing existing floors to improve aesthetics, increase durability, or address damage. Before requesting finished floor installation, homeowners usually want to understand the types of flooring available, the suitability for their specific space, and any preparation or surface requirements needed for a successful installation.
It’s important for property owners to consider factors like the current subfloor condition, the level of foot traffic in the area, and how the chosen flooring material will complement their interior design. Clarifying the scope of the project, including whether existing flooring needs removal and what finishing options are available, can help ensure expectations are aligned. Proper planning and understanding of these details can contribute to a smooth installation process and a finished result that meets both aesthetic and practical needs.

Finished Floor Installation Questions
What types of floors can be installed? Various options include hardwood, laminate, vinyl, tile, and carpet, suitable for different rooms and styles.
Is floor preparation necessary before installation? Yes, existing surfaces should be prepared to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ish.
Can finished floors be installed over existing flooring? In many cases, new flooring can be installed over existing surfaces if they are in good condition.
What should property owners consider when choosing a flooring material? Durability, style, and the specific needs of each space are key factors in selecting the right flooring option.
